20. Find the area of square of side 4 cm. If the side of square is doubled, find the area of the resulting new
square.

Step-by-step explanation:
Area of a square= side×side = 4×4 = 16cm^2
After doubling the side,we will get 4×2=8cm
Therefore,
area of the new square = s×s = 8×8 = 64cm^2
